WalkingOne bit Test: For each address, data one is written and read back for testing. Then shift the data left one bit, so the data becomes two and perform the same test again. It repeats for 32 times until the test bit is shifted out of test data. The same is test is repeated for entire test range.

Pseudo Random Data Test: A pre-calculated pseudo random data is used to write a unique data into each test RAM. After the first pass the test, the program reads back one more time to insure data stays correct.

Default: Enabled

B5. MBUF SRAM via DMA Test

Function: Eight test pattern data are used in the test. They are described below. A 0x1000 sized data buffer is used for this test. Before each pattern test, the buffer is initialized and filled with the test pattern. It then performs size 0x1000 transmit DMA from host buffer to NIC MBUF memory. Verify the data integrity in MBUF against host memory and repeat the DMA for the entire MBUF buffer. Then it performs receive DMA from NIC to host. The 0x1000-byte test buffer is cleared to zero before each receive-DMA. Verify the data integrity and test is repeated for the entire MBUF SRAM range. See Table 8 on page 125.
